Abstract :
Oxygen evolution reaction was studied in alkaline medium on a nickel hydroxide electrode modified by electroless cobalt coating. The presence of cobalt coating at the surface of nickel hydroxide can increase the oxygen evolution overpotential promoting full charge of the electrode. It has been found that the oxygen evolution potential at this kind of electrode was apparently higher than that on the nickel hydroxide electrode added with cobalt powder as a conductor. Kinetic studies have also shown that this kind of electrode has a greater Tafel slope for oxygen evolution reaction. The mechanism of oxygen evolution has also been discussed.
